Which local anesthetic is often preferred for patients requiring hemostatic control?

Explanation:
Lidocaine with epinephrine is often preferred for procedures requiring hemostatic control because the addition of epinephrine, a vasoconstrictor, constricts blood vessels in the area of injection. This vasoconstriction reduces blood flow, which not only helps to minimize bleeding during the procedure but also prolongs the duration of the anesthetic effect. By limiting blood supply, it allows the local anesthetic to stay localized in the tissue, thereby providing more effective pain control. This choice stands out particularly for surgical and dental procedures where hemostasis is essential. Epinephrine also reduces the systemic absorption of the anesthetic, leading to lower peak plasma levels and potentially fewer systemic side effects. Although other local anesthetics like articaine and bupivacaine may have their own merits, they don’t universally provide this specific benefit of hemostatic control to the same extent as lidocaine with epinephrine does. Plain procaine does not offer any vasoconstrictive properties, which means it would not help in controlling bleeding during surgical procedures. Thus, in the context of hemostatic control, lidocaine with epinephrine is the preferred choice.
